Written question asked by William Cash (Conservative), in the House of Commons. It was due for an answer on Thursday, 28 November 1991. It was answered by Angela Rumbold (Conservative) on Thursday, 28 November 1991 on behalf of the Home Office.
Untitled Written question
- Question
- If he will make it his policy not to support the provisions of the Data Protection Directive which would prevent airline tickets being issued across the boundaries of Member States of the European Community.
